Los Angeles Dodgers first baseman Freddie Freeman was sidelined for both games of the Tokyo Series due to discomfort in his left rib. The injury also kept him out of the team’s season opener against the Chicago Cubs. While Freeman had hoped to play, the Dodgers opted for caution to prevent further complications.

Manager Dave Roberts explained that Freeman was eager to take the field but ultimately agreed with the medical staff’s recommendation to sit out. Despite this, Roberts expressed optimism that Freeman could be ready for the upcoming Freeway Series against the Los Angeles Angels. Roberts stated, “He lobbied hard like he always does. He wants to play every day. He kind of prepared to play but ultimately conceded to myself and the training staff. It’s just too early in the season to potentially put him in harm’s way.” (via MLB

Freeman’s discomfort resurfaced during batting practice on Tuesday in the same area where he previously suffered a rib cartilage fracture during the 2023 postseason. However, he noted that the pain was not as severe. Team doctors suspect the issue may be linked to scar tissue from the previous injury rather than a new problem.

Although Freeman could not play in the Tokyo Series, he participated in two exhibition games. These were against the Yomiuri Giants and Hanshin Tigers. His status for the Freeway Series remains uncertain, but the Dodgers are hopeful he will soon return to play.
